This fellowship opportunity at the National Institute of Standards and Technology (NIST) focuses on advancing the measurement science of nanomaterial surfaces, which critically influence nanomaterial behavior as their size decreases below 100 nm. Fellows will have access to state-of-the-art instrumentation including an imaging X-ray photoelectron spectrometer (XPS), transmission electron microscopy (TEM), scanning electron microscopy (SEM), scanning probe microscopies, and infrared spectroscopy.
